      Tokyo Verdy had a decent performance last season, finishing 5th in the Eastern Division with 7 wins, 4 draws, and 7 losses. However, their offensive capabilities were not outstanding, as they only managed 19 goals in 18 games, preferring a more conservative style of play. On the other hand, Kawasaki Frontale suffered a 0 - 1 defeat at home to Sanfrecce Hiroshima in their last league match, losing both of their recent games, a decline from their previous form of 1 win and 1 draw. They've conceded goals in their last 5 games, a total of 6, which, although not a large number, still poses a potential risk. In addition, Kawasaki Frontale were shut out in 3 of their last 6 away league games, indicating that their away - game attacking line is relatively weak. Tokyo Verdy didn't play any friendlies before the new season. In their last seven games, they only had one win, two draws, and four losses. Moreover, they've lost their last two home games in a row.       In the comparison between the initial and real - time data of the match, Tokyo Verdy shows several advantages over Kawasaki Frontale. In terms of offensive performance, Tokyo Verdy has a better conversion rate in finishing attacks, with 18.2% compared to Kawasaki's 12.4%. Their xG efficiency is also higher, at 1.32 against 0.98. The key pass success rate of Tokyo Verdy is 67%, while Kawasaki's is only 59%. And in terms of the value of forward passes, Tokyo Verdy reaches 14.3, outperforming Kawasaki's 11.6. In midfield, Tokyo Verdy has stronger control. They have a 58% ball - possession rate, leaving Kawasaki with only 42%. The conversion speed of Tokyo Verdy is also faster, with 1.2 seconds compared to 1.6 seconds of Kawasaki. The average running distance of Tokyo Verdy players is 11.2 km per game, while that of Kawasaki is only 9.8 km.
